what is a floppet? wrote:what is a floppet?
A floppet is an omnivorous marine mammal, with the exception of gills and fins. They are the only known mammal with gills as far as we know. They have either long or short fur, depending on their mutations. They vary in size, color, mutation and personality. They are exceptionally intelligent, and adore attention. Floppets tend to live in groups called " Flops ". They are social creatures, and can become depressed if they haven't interacted with other floppets for long periods of time. They are very friendly, and lovable animals. Will you take one home today?

Floppets were first discovered off the coast of the Galapagos, which is the perfect climate and habitat for these beasts. They were first spotted in the late 1800s, long after Charles Darwin's study of the islands. They were believed to be one of the reasons " mermaid sightings " became fairly common, due to their long fish-like tail, but later on upon closer examination they were discovered to be canine like fish. Like fish, they have gills and fins. Thus giving them their scientific name, Pieces Canis, meaning fish dog in latin. They are often compared to seals, as their large blubbery legs resemble that of a seal's skin, and the way they move on land is similar to a seal. On occasion, Floppets could be spotted wandering around in a rookery of seals. Although humans first encountered them on these islands, new evidence has shown that they may have originated in Antarctica.

Scientists believe that Floppets once lived in the frigid waters of Antarctica, due to the fact they have fur. Most marine mammals have little to no fur, but Floppets seem to be the exception. With this research, scientists decided to look for more evidence that floppets have lived in Antarctica, and after years of expedition, remains that trace back to Floppets have been found. Floppets are still being researched, and many more questions have risen about these animals. How did they get from Antarctica to the Galapagos? Why do their whisker barbs glow? How long have these animals been around? Scientists are working hard to discover these answers.

As of recent, Floppets have been domesticated, and docile floppets have been bred to create a new population of house-friendly Floppets. They have since become wildly popular in demand as a household pet, and they have seem to have adapted to their climate and conditions. The best we can do to study them ourselves is by keeping one as a pet. They have grown more common and accepted into society, and are thought of as normal pets. They do demand a lot of grooming and a large area of space to keep them healthy and happy though. If you think you're ready to own one and study your new friend, then you've come to the right place.

● Floppets are highly intelligent and are thought to be sentient.

● Floppets have excellent hearing, even underwater.

● On land, they move similar to a seal, thus they are called Floppets.

● Floppets are extremely graceful underwater.

● Although it is still uncertain what they use their whisker barbs for,
it is thought they use it to attract prey or to attract a mate.

● Floppets can change the amount of light that comes out of their
whisker barbs.

● They have been recorded to live up to 30 years in the wild.

● They don't have to mate for life, but some Floppets prefer it that way.

● A breeding usually results in up to 2 pups.

● Same sex Floppets can breed and produce offspring.

● Floppets are harmless to humans.

● They can range in size from a small German Shepard to a large Gray wolf.

● Have a wide range in sound, including various clicks, barks, whistles,
grunts, and indescribable sounds.

● Can identify most colors and shapes, some have even been known to count
up to 20.

● surprisingly, they can ingest chocolate, avocados and other harmful things to
other animal species.
